Harvest Crusade Family Tragedy
Christopher Laurie, the art director at Harvest and the 33-year-old son of evangelist and Harvest Crusade organizer Greg Laurie, was killed Thursday morning in a car accident in Corona, California. Apparently he rear-ended a 12-foot-tall Caltrans truck that was in a roadwork convoy in the carpool lane. The California Highway Patrol estimates that the truck was doing approximately 15 mph and Laurie was going too fast to keep from hitting it. Caltrans spokeswoman Shelli Lombardo said Christopher Laurie's car hit the dump truck's attenuator, also known as a crash cushion.In addition to his parents, Greg and Cathe Laurie, Christopher Laurie is survived by his wife, Brittany, who is due to give birth in November, his 2-year-old daughter, Stella and his younger brother Jonathan.
